资讯月刊下载

第121期(18-03)

2018年03月 - 总第121期
  • Java程序员开发常用的工具
  • 3月全球数据库排名:PostgreSQL 再迎暴涨
点击下载>>

第120期(18-02)

2018年02月 - 总第120期
  • 开源巨献:2017 年 Google 开源了这些超赞的项目
  • 关于区块链,程序员需要了解什么
点击下载>>

第119期(18-01)

2018年01月 - 总第119期
  • 编写高性能Java代码的最佳实践
  • 从15000个Python开源项目中精选的Top30,Github平均star为3707,赶紧收藏!
点击下载>>

更多月刊下载

活跃编辑

资讯编辑

转载新闻 [研发管理] 项目开发:速度 vs. 质量

本文作者系程序员Daniel F Pupius,这是一篇他发表在Medium上的博文,讲述自己怎么在实际写代码的过程中,发现在速度和质量间做出抉择其实是个伪命题。 程序开发项目进行过程中,通常会冒出这样的困惑:应该选择效率,还是选择质量?很多程序员都会有偷懒的思维,觉得把一些摸不清头绪、不知道怎么写的代码片段去掉,可以节省很多时间,更早完成项目计划。 其实过去几年中,我也是这么想的,但最近我 ...
WnouM 评论(6) 有13044人浏览 2013-05-09 5 0

原创新闻 [开源软件] 开源软件质量报告:连续两年高于行业平均值

开发测试服务提供商Coverity近日发布了一份开源软件质量报告——《2012 Coverity Scan Open Source Report》。 该项研究始于2006年,最初由Coverity公司和美国国土安全部合作进行,旨在研究开源软件的完整性,现在由Coverity公司负责进行。 Coverity的扫描报告已经成为了一个衡量开源软件质量状态的被广泛接受的标准,在过去的7年时间,Cover ...
wangguo 评论(1) 有9005人浏览 2013-05-08 1 0

翻译新闻 [研发管理] 开发人员常说的一些话,你有没有中枪

下面是一些软件开发人员在工作中比较常用到的一些语句,看看你有没有中枪。 1. 那不是我的代码 应用中被发现了一处bug,刚开始时我有一丝害怕,但庆幸的是,这部分代码不是我写的,于是我很高兴地告诉经理,“那不是我的代码,可能是同事A写的,你问问他吧”。 2. 它在我电脑上可以运行 测试人员发现我的代码无法正常运行,但是相同的情况下,在我的开发机上可以正常运行,于是我很爽快地回了邮件“程序没 ...
wangguo 评论(20) 有12429人浏览 2013-04-09 6 1

转载新闻 [移动开发] 开发者福音:应用测试平台 TestFlight 将推 Android ...

App 测试平台 TestFlight 解决了许多 iOS 开发者测试 app 时的烦恼,到目前为止 iOS 开发者已上传超过 30 万个 app 到 TestFlight 中,而在过去 90 天的时间里,上传的 app 就达到 10 万个左右。Adobe、Disney、Tumblr 等都是 TestFlight 的用户。 根据 TC 的报道,TestFlight 现在已经支持 Android 平 ...
WnouM 评论(0) 有4395人浏览 2013-02-21 1 0

转载新闻 [Web前端] 微软发布modern.IE,免费的Web开发者测试工具集合

微软今天发布了modern.IE,这是一系列免费的、针对Web 开发者的测试工具和资源集合网站,微软希望以此来帮助开发者更轻松地实现跨 IE 和其他现代浏览器、跨设备的兼容性,其他还有代码检测工具、标准代码建议,以及 IE10 推介。 微软也和 BrowserStack 合作免费为开发者提供了 3 个月的免费远程渲染测试服务,可随时通过登录 Facebook 帐号来激活服务,最晚到明年 1 月 ...
WnouM 评论(2) 有5495人浏览 2013-02-01 2 0

转载新闻 [移动开发] TestObject:为开发者摆平Android碎片化问题

作为全世界最大的移动生态体系,Android 最大的问题之一是碎片化。对于应用开发者而言,为了确保自己的产品能够在各色各样的 Android 设备上正常运行,需要耗费大量的时间和精力。 为了帮助应用开发者更加便捷地完成 QA 环节,不少第三方应用测试服务油然而生,我们国内也不乏此类产品。大部分应用测试服务使用的都是劳动密集型的测试方法,由人工检测,对应用在不同 Android 系统下的运行情况给 ...
WnouM 评论(2) 有4409人浏览 2013-01-22 2 1

原创新闻 [Web前端] 最全的 Web 开发项目检查清单

在完成Web应用的功能性开发工作后,你还需要对其进行各种测试、调优。由于需要测试的方面较多,有可能会遗漏一些重要的测试项。 WebDevCheckList这个网站提供了一个完整的测试清单,并在每一个测试项中提供了一些帮助信息和测试工具。测试后,你还可以在复选框中打勾,以避免遗漏。 测试项涵盖: 可用性 代码质量 性能 安全 移动端 SEO 最佳实践 Google分析 语义 无障碍访问 你可 ...
wangguo 评论(0) 有9728人浏览 2013-01-08 10 1

原创新闻 [Web前端] 16 个高效测试响应式设计界面的工具

响应式的设计现在越来越受设计师推崇,面对这越来越多的响应式设计页面,我们需要找到高效的测试工具来验证设计的合理和正确,在今天这篇文章中,我们将介绍16款帮助你在线测试响应式页面设计的工具,希望大家喜欢! 1. Responsinator Responsinator提供了大家在不同设备viewport下查看网站效果的特性,提供了iphone,android,ipad,kindle及其多种设备上的预 ...
jjfat 评论(0) 有6301人浏览 2012-12-25 0 0

原创新闻 [开源软件] CasperJS 1.0 发布,Web应用自动化测试工具

CasperJS是一个开源的导航脚本处理和测试工具,基于PhantomJS(前端自动化测试工具)编写。CasperJS简化了完整的导航场景的过程定义,提供了用于完成常见任务的实用的高级函数、方法和语法糖。 其主要功能包括: 定义和整理导航步骤 表单填充 点击、跟踪链接 区域、页面截图 断言远程DOM 日志、事件 资源下载,包括二进制资源 捕捉错误,并做出相应的响应 编写功能测试套件,并将结果 ...
wangguo 评论(0) 有4520人浏览 2012-12-25 1 0

转载新闻 [移动开发] 测试平台 Kickfolio:在浏览器上测试 iOS 应用

可以让开发者在浏览器上测试其 iOS 应用的 Kickfolio 正式对开发者开放。Kickfolio 是一家 500 Startups 资助的初创企业,跟 Facebook 收购的 Pieceable 或面向 Android 的 Appsurfer 类似,他可以让开发者上传移动应用的编译模块到 Kickfolio 的平台上,然后可以让其他人在 web 上与 app 交互,无需下载测试执行代码到移动 ...
WnouM 评论(0) 有2874人浏览 2012-12-10 1 0

原创新闻 [移动开发] Android UI 测试框架 zinc30 发布

Zinc30是一个强大的Android UI自动化测试框架,支持建立健壮、可维护的黑盒测试用例。RD或者QA能够基于场景设计功能级和系统级测试。Zinc30符合Webdriver的 API规范,以更好地面向对象编程的方式来操作Android控件,同时全面支持Web UI测试中流行的PageFactory模式。 项目地址:https://code.google.com/p/zinc30/ Gett ...
chasezjj 评论(0) 有6064人浏览 2012-12-06 5 0

翻译新闻 [研发管理] 作为开发/测试人员,你永远不要这么说

在软件行业,开发人员、测试人员缺一不可,但他们之间的关系并不是那么“和谐”。因为测试人员的职责就是给开发人员的作品挑毛病,有时候,争吵在所难免。 尽管如此,但为了保证软件的质量,还是要进行无数次的沟通、反馈。但要注意,下面的这些话不应该出自一名优秀的测试人员或者开发人员之口。 如果你是一名测试人员,这些话一定不要说: 这没bug,我保证! 反正没有人使用Firefox。 Cem Kaner ...
wangguo 评论(6) 有10213人浏览 2012-11-02 1 21

转载新闻 [移动开发] Twitter 开源移动测试工具 Clutch.IO

之前 Twitter 收购了应用测试平台公司 Clutch.IO,今天 Twitter 宣布将该公司旗下的测试工具开源,使用 Apache 授权协议。开源后项目托管在 Github 上,地址是:https://github.com/clutchio Clutch.IO 是一个移动应用的A/B测试工具,可测试原生应用和HTML应用,支持 Android 和 iOS 平台。 所谓 A/B 测试,简单 ...
MnouW 评论(0) 有2833人浏览 2012-10-12 1 0

原创新闻 [互联网] Web应用安全问题频出,源于漏洞测试过少

软件厂商Coverity 近日发布了一个软件安全风险报告,报告显示,在欧洲和北美的240个有影响力的web开发商中,少于五分之二的开发商进行安全方面的测试,超过一半的开发商拒绝检查代码中的bug和安全漏洞。这导致的结果是,安全事件出现更频繁,从而使整体开发成本提高。 在报告中列出了以下数据: 超过70%的开发商经历过安全事件,且都抱怨缺少安全方面技术以及对开发人员的监管,此外也有项目扩展和预算 ...
wangguo 评论(0) 有4059人浏览 2012-09-20 2 2

翻译新闻 [Web前端] 优秀Web开发者必须知道的10件事

“开发工作不仅仅只是写代码”这句话来自3EV网站的Dan Frost,他在一篇文章中阐述了开发过程中应该注意的一些事项。原文内容如下: 开发者是创造数字世界的主力军,他们不应该只扮演编程工具的角色,而应该对开发工作有更高的要求。那么,开发者可以从哪些方面提高开发能力呢?下面我就谈一下我的想法。我的建议可能不全面,但希望能够给你带来一些帮助。 1. 不要只盯着代码 如今人人都会写代码。很多业余爱 ...
csdn_0000 评论(8) 有10076人浏览 2012-09-11 13 1

转载新闻 [移动开发] Twitter 收购应用测试平台 Clutch.io

Twitter 日前再度开出收购支票,其宣布收购美国从事移动应用软件测试平台开发的 Clutch.io 公司。 Clutch.io主要服务对象是移动应用开发人员,通过测试平台,开发人员可以优化其应用程序,并且实现方便的部署。 该公司表示,近期将会允许开发人员用户下载其之前上传的数据,未来,公司也将会推出免费工具,让开发人员继续使用软件测试服务。 Clutch.io 在官方博客正式宣布了加盟 ...
MnouW 评论(0) 有2847人浏览 2012-08-14 0 0

翻译新闻 [研发管理] 开发流程那些事:6天时间修改1行代码

企业中,产品研发是一项综合性的工作,需要多个部门参与。但往往会出现各种各样的问题,如部门协作困难、全局监控难等,这困扰着大多数的企业。 本文是一个真实的案例: 菲利普(主 席):我们工厂中有10%的员工没有充分利用,要么我们开始处理更多的积压工作,要么进行裁员。我宁愿每个人都很忙。我们该如何做? 李(业务部经理):公司政策规定,我们要处理3个月内的积压工作,如果改成4个月,我们将有大量的工作。 ...
wangguo 评论(27) 有17698人浏览 2012-05-18 12 6

转载新闻 [行业应用] CodeNow:在浏览器中实时测试 API 调用代码

几乎所有互联网巨头都会开放自己的API,但是对于开发者来说,首次接触这些 API 却是件棘手的事。在开始写第一行代码之前,也许要花费几个小时来做好设置、获得权限,而且还要学习相关语法。但在最近,由 Amazon 前员工设立的初创企业 CodeNow.com 则针对这一问题,提供服务帮助开发者简化测试 API 前的准备步骤。 网站创始人Yash Kumar是 Amazon 的前员工,创办该网站的灵 ...
nemohq 评论(3) 有5429人浏览 2012-05-07 5 0

转载新闻 [研发管理] 软件开发中需要专职的 QA 吗?

导读:相信很多软件开发企业都有专职 QA。然而,这些专职人员能否发挥其本身价值?我们是否需要专职的QA?针对这些问题,本文作者提出了他的看法。 以下为文章原文: 这个文章必然是有争议的,我在我的微博上讨论过很多次了,每次都是很有争议的。对于不同的观点,有争论总是一件好事,这样可以引发大家的思考。所以,对于我的这篇博文,如果你赞同我的观点,我会感到高兴;如果你会去认真地深入思考,我也会高兴;如果你 ...
nemohq 评论(32) 有12062人浏览 2012-04-11 14 3

原创新闻 [移动开发] Facebook开源其移动浏览器测试套件Ringmark

Facebook近日开源了移动浏览器测试套件Ringmark。 Ringmark是Facebook和Bocoup(开放式Web技术开发公司)共同开发,在今年2月份首次推出,目的是帮助开发者了解移动设备浏览器是否支持他们的应用所需要的功能。 在Ringmark套件中,每组测试项目被设置成一个“环”,环越大,表示包含的功能和测试项就越多。环也可以用来表示设备浏览器所支持功能的水平。例如,当开发者听 ...
wangguo 评论(0) 有3474人浏览 2012-04-06 0 0

最近热门TAG

Java(1854) Google(1441) Android(1244) JavaScript(842) Web(669) Linux(648) 框架(605) Windows(591) 浏览器(540) HTML5(533) Firefox(483) jQuery(480) iOS(479) Ruby(427) Chrome(386) HTML(380) 编程(365) 工作(349) Apache(346) Python(328)

热门资讯

Global site tag (gtag.js) - Google Analytics